The term "www movierulz 2025" refers to a variant of the Movierulz domain, a long-standing online platform notorious for distributing pirated movies, television shows, and other copyrighted media without proper authorization. These platforms typically host or link to a vast library of content, often including recent theatrical releases and popular streaming titles, making them accessible to users worldwide. The "2025" in the domain name often indicates a new iteration or a specific year of operation, a common tactic used by such sites to evade legal shutdowns and maintain accessibility as previous domains are blocked or seized.
The continued prevalence and apparent "trending" status of domains like "www movierulz 2025" stem from several factors. The platform's perceived value proposition of free access to otherwise premium content remains a significant draw. Despite the proliferation of legal streaming services, some users seek alternatives to subscription costs or geographical content restrictions. Furthermore, these sites often adapt quickly to new content releases, sometimes making movies available shortly after their theatrical debut, which fuels their popularity among specific user demographics. The persistent cat-and-mouse game between copyright holders and pirate sites also contributes to their visibility, as each new domain change or legal battle draws media attention.

The existence and sustained operation of platforms like "www movierulz 2025" have a profound impact on the global entertainment industry. They directly contribute to revenue losses for filmmakers, studios, distributors, and content creators, undermining the economic viability of creative endeavors. This erosion of revenue can stifle innovation and reduce investment in new productions. Beyond direct financial harm, piracy also affects job security within the entertainment sector, from production crews to marketing teams. The ongoing battle against such sites highlights the constant need for robust copyright protection and effective digital rights management strategies, as well as consumer education on the ethical and legal implications of content consumption.

Economically, digital piracy represented by sites like Movierulz continues to divert billions of dollars annually from legitimate content markets. Reports from organizations such as the Digital Citizens Alliance and major entertainment industry associations consistently highlight the financial drain caused by illicit streaming and downloading. This financial impact is felt across the ecosystem, from individual artists struggling to profit from their work to large studios facing diminished returns on massive investments. Socially, the ease of access to free, albeit illegal, content normalizes the idea of bypassing payment for creative works, potentially undermining the perceived value of intellectual property. This creates a challenging environment for fostering a culture of fair compensation for artists and creators, impacting the long-term health of creative industries.
